
Roger Glover
Roger Glover is a British musician best known as the bassist and a songwriter for the legendary rock band Deep Purple. Joining the band in 1969, he contributed to their distinctive sound with his innovative bass playing and songwriting skills. Beyond his work with Deep Purple, Glover has also produced albums for other artists and has pursued solo projects. His musical style blends rock, hard rock, and heavy metal, helping shape the evolution of modern rock music. Glover’s influence extends through decades of rock history, making him a respected figure in the music industry.
